Jason Roth is a scholar working on Epidemiology, Infectious Diseases and Animal Science and Zoology. According to data from OpenAlex, Jason Roth has authored 15 papers receiving a total of 197 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Epidemiology, 6 papers in Infectious Diseases and 4 papers in Animal Science and Zoology. Recurrent topics in Jason Roth's work include Respiratory viral infections research (8 papers), Virology and Viral Diseases (8 papers) and Virus-based gene therapy research (4 papers). Jason Roth is often cited by papers focused on Respiratory viral infections research (8 papers), Virology and Viral Diseases (8 papers) and Virus-based gene therapy research (4 papers). Jason Roth collaborates with scholars based in United States and China. Jason Roth's co-authors include Qingzhong Yu, Laszlo Zsak, Douglas P. Jasmer, Peter J. Myler, Carlos Estévez, Bo Liu, Dale L. Barnard, Donald F. Smee, Joseph K.-K. Li and John D. Morrey and has published in prestigious journals such as Scientific Reports, Biochemical and Biophysical Research Communications and Archives of Physical Medicine and Rehabilitation.
